Lines Matching refs:rec_len
420 unsigned int name_len, rec_len; in ext2fs_dirent_swab_in2() local
427 dirent->rec_len = ext2fs_swab16(dirent->rec_len); in ext2fs_dirent_swab_in2()
432 retval = ext2fs_get_rec_len(fs, dirent, &rec_len); in ext2fs_dirent_swab_in2()
435 if ((rec_len < 8) || (rec_len % 4)) { in ext2fs_dirent_swab_in2()
436 rec_len = 8; in ext2fs_dirent_swab_in2()
438 } else if (((name_len & 0xFF) + 8) > rec_len) in ext2fs_dirent_swab_in2()
440 p += rec_len; in ext2fs_dirent_swab_in2()
456 unsigned int rec_len; in ext2fs_dirent_swab_out2() local
463 retval = ext2fs_get_rec_len(fs, dirent, &rec_len); in ext2fs_dirent_swab_out2()
466 if ((rec_len < 8) || in ext2fs_dirent_swab_out2()
467 (rec_len % 4)) { in ext2fs_dirent_swab_out2()
471 p += rec_len; in ext2fs_dirent_swab_out2()
473 dirent->rec_len = ext2fs_swab16(dirent->rec_len); in ext2fs_dirent_swab_out2()